タグ付けされた質問 「jquery」

jQueryはJavaScriptライブラリです。JavaScriptタグの追加も検討してください。jQueryは人気のあるクロスブラウザーJavaScriptライブラリであり、ブラウザー間の不一致を最小限に抑えることで、ドキュメントオブジェクトモデル(DOM)トラバーサル、イベント処理、アニメーション、AJAXインタラクションを促進します。jQueryのタグが付いた質問はjQueryに関連している必要があるため、問題のコードはjQueryを使用する必要があり、少なくともjQueryの使用法に関連する要素を質問に含める必要があります。

30
jQueryで要素を「フラッシュ」する方法
私はjQueryを初めて使用し、Prototypeを使用した経験があります。プロトタイプには、要素を「フラッシュ」するメソッドがあります。それを別の色で簡単に強調表示し、通常の色にフェードバックして、ユーザーの目を引き付けます。jQueryにそのようなメソッドはありますか?fadeIn、fadeOut、およびアニメーションが表示されますが、「フラッシュ」のようなものは表示されません。おそらく、これら3つのうちの1つを適切な入力で使用できますか?

14
jQuery:jQueryの非表示要素の高さを取得する
非表示のdiv内にある要素の高さを取得する必要があります。現在、divを表示し、高さを取得し、親divを非表示にします。これは少しばかげているようです。もっと良い方法はありますか? 私はjQuery 1.4.2を使用しています: $select.show(); optionHeight = $firstOption.height(); //we can only get height if its visible $select.hide();
249 javascript  jquery  html  css 

19
HTML5:整数のみを取る数値入力タイプ?
私はjQueryツールを使用しています を介してHTML5検証を実装 Validatorを。これまでのところ、1つのことを除いて、うまく機能しています。HTML5仕様では、入力タイプ「数値」は整数と浮動小数点数の両方を持つことができます。これは、データベースフィールドが符号付き浮動小数点数である場合にのみ有効なバリデーターとなるため、信じられないほど近視眼的です(符号なしintの場合、「パターン」検証にフォールバックする必要があり、そのため、アップやダウンなどの追加機能が失われますそれをサポートするブラウザの矢印)。入力を単に符号なし整数に制限する別の入力タイプまたはおそらく属性がありますか?見つかりませんでした、ありがとう。 編集 わかりました、皆さん、時間と手助けに感謝しますが、多くの不当な賛成投票が行われているのがわかります。ステップを1に設定しても、入力が制限されないため、答えにはなりません。テキストボックスに負の浮動小数点数を入力することもできます。また、私はパターン検証を認識しています(元の投稿で触れました)が、それは質問の一部ではありませんでした。HTML5でタイプ「数値」の入力を正の整数値に制限できるかどうか知りたいと思いました。この質問に対する答えは、「いいえ、そうではない」でしょう。jQueryツールの検証を使用するときにいくつかの欠点が発生するため、パターン検証を使用したくありませんでしたが、仕様ではこれを行うためのより明確な方法が許可されていないようです。

8
jquery .html()と.append()
空のdivがあるとしましょう: <div id='myDiv'></div> これは: $('#myDiv').html("<div id='mySecondDiv'></div>"); と同じ: var mySecondDiv=$("<div id='mySecondDiv'></div>"); $('#myDiv').append(mySecondDiv);
248 jquery  html 

14
div id jQueryへのスムーズスクロール
div id jqueryコードへのスクロールが正しく機能するようにしています。別のスタックオーバーフローの質問に基づいて、私は以下を試しました デモhttp://jsfiddle.net/kevinPHPkevin/8tLdq/ $('#myButton').click(function() { $.scrollTo($('#myDiv'), 1000); }); しかし、それはうまくいきませんでした。divにスナップします。私も試しました $('#myButton').click(function(event) { event.preventDefault(); $.scrollTo($('#myDiv'), 1000); }); 進展なし。

8
$(document).ready shorthand
次の省略形$(document).readyですか? (function($){ //some code })(jQuery); このパターンが頻繁に使用されているのを確認しましたが、それに対する参照を見つけることができません。の省略形である場合$(document).ready()、機能しない特別な理由はありますか?私のテストでは、readyイベントの前に常に起動するようです。

12
jQuery日付/時刻ピッカー[終了]
閉まっている。この質問はスタックオーバーフローのガイドラインを満たしていません。現在、回答を受け付けていません。 この質問を改善してみませんか?Stack Overflowのトピックとなるように質問を更新します。 6年前休業。 ロックされています。この質問とトピックへの回答はロックされています。質問はトピックから外れていますが、歴史的に重要です。現在、新しい回答や相互作用を受け入れていません。 日付と時刻の両方を処理できる適切なjQueryプラグインを探していました。コアUI DatePickerはすばらしいですが、残念ながら私も時間をかけることができる必要があります。 DatePickerが時間とともに機能するためのハッキングをいくつか見つけましたが、それらはすべて非常に洗練されていないようで、Googleは何もうまくいきません。 使用可能なインターフェイスを持つ単一のUIコントロールで日付と時刻を選択するための優れたjQueryプラグインはありますか?

14
jQuery .load応答がキャッシュされないようにする
次のコードでURLに対してGETリクエストを作成しています。 $('#searchButton').click(function() { $('#inquiry').load('/portal/?f=searchBilling&pid=' + $('#query').val()); }); ただし、返された結果が常に反映されるとは限りません。たとえば、スタックトレースを吐く応答を変更しましたが、検索ボタンをクリックしてもスタックトレースが表示されませんでした。ajax応答を制御する基本的なPHPコードを調べたところ、正しいコードがあり、ページに直接アクセスすると正しい結果が表示されましたが、.loadから返された出力は古いものでした。 ブラウザを閉じて再度開くと、一度動作してから古い情報を返し始めます。これをjQueryで制御できますか、それともキャッシュを制御するためにPHPスクリプト出力ヘッダーが必要ですか?
244 jquery  ajax  caching 

8
jQuery AJAXリクエストをキャンセル/中止する方法は?
5秒ごとに行われるAJAXリクエストがあります。しかし、問題はAJAXリクエストの前にあります。前のリクエストが完了していない場合、そのリクエストを中止して新しいリクエストを作成する必要があります。 私のコードはこのようなものです、この問題を解決するにはどうすればよいですか? $(document).ready( var fn = function(){ $.ajax({ url: 'ajax/progress.ftl', success: function(data) { //do something } }); }; var interval = setInterval(fn, 500); );
244 ajax  jquery 



8
戻る前に、Ajax呼び出しが完了するのをjQueryに待機させるにはどうすればよいですか?
ログインが必要なサーバー側の機能があります。ユーザーがログインしている場合、関数は成功すると1を返します。そうでない場合、関数はログインページを返します。 AjaxとjQueryを使用して関数を呼び出したいのですが。私が行うことは、クリック機能が適用された通常のリンクを使用してリクエストを送信することです。ユーザーがログインしていないか、関数が失敗した場合、Ajax呼び出しがtrueを返すようにして、hrefがトリガーされるようにします。 ただし、次のコードを使用すると、Ajax呼び出しが完了する前に関数が終了します。 ユーザーをログインページに適切にリダイレクトするにはどうすればよいですか? $(".my_link").click( function(){ $.ajax({ url: $(this).attr('href'), type: 'GET', cache: false, timeout: 30000, error: function(){ return true; }, success: function(msg){ if (parseFloat(msg)){ return false; } else { return true; } } }); });
243 jquery  ajax 

9
DOM要素を最初の子として設定する方法は?
要素Eがあり、それにいくつかの要素を追加しています。突然、次の要素はEの最初の子であることがわかりました。トリックは何ですか、どのように行うのですか?Eは配列ではなくオブジェクトであるため、メソッドunshiftは機能しません。 長い道のりはEの子供たちを繰り返し、key ++を移動することですが、もっときれいな方法があると私は確信しています。

16
どこからjQueryライブラリを含めますか?Google JSAPI?CDN?
jQueryとjQuery UIを含める方法はいくつかありますが、人々は何を使っているのでしょうか? Google JSAPI jQueryのサイト 自分のサイト/サーバー 別のCDN 私は最近Google JSAPIを使用していますが、SSL接続のセットアップ、またはgoogle.comの解決だけに長い時間がかかることがわかりました。私はGoogleで以下を使用しています。 <script src="https://www.google.com/jsapi"></script> <script> google.load('jquery', '1.3.1'); </script> 他のサイトにアクセスしたときにキャッシュされ、サーバーの帯域幅を節約するためにGoogleを使用するのが好きですが、サイトの遅い部分のままである場合は、インクルードを変​​更する場合があります。 あなたは何を使うのですか?何か問題がありましたか? 編集: jQueryのサイトにアクセスしたばかりで、次の方法を使用しています: <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.3/jquery.min.js"></script> Edit2:昨年問題なくjQueryを含めてきた方法は次のとおりです。 <script src="//ajax.googleapis.com/ajax/libs/jquery/1.4.3/jquery.min.js"></script> 違いは、の削除ですhttp:。これを削除すると、httpとhttpsの切り替えについて心配する必要がなくなります。

3
jQuery AJAX GET呼び出しでリクエストヘッダーを渡す
jQueryを使用してAJAX GETでリクエストヘッダーを渡そうとしています。次のブロックでは、「data」がクエリ文字列の値を自動的に渡します。代わりに、そのデータをリクエストヘッダーで渡す方法はありますか? $.ajax({ url: "http://localhost/PlatformPortal/Buyers/Account/SignIn", data: { signature: authHeader }, type: "GET", success: function() { alert('Success!' + authHeader); } }); 以下も機能しませんでした $.ajax({ url: "http://localhost/PlatformPortal/Buyers/Account/SignIn", beforeSend: { signature: authHeader }, async: false, type: "GET", success: function() { alert('Success!' + authHeader); } });
242 jquery  ajax  client-side 

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.